3D Printing Enclosure. An enclosure will keep the temperature in the vicinity of the print bed more homogeneous, protecting the area from drafts, but also from dust. Enclosure can greatly improve the print quality of abs and reduce the noise and the smell produced by the printer. But if you want to build one, there are some factors to consider.
